• Non ci sono risultati.

3.3 Applicazioni oggetto di valutazione

3.3.2 Google Translate

La prima applicazione oggetto di valutazione è Google Translate, sviluppata da Google Inc., disponibile gratuitamente per i sistemi operativi Android e iOS e scaricabile da smartphone e tablet (in questo caso scaricata da smartphone). L'applicazione si basa sul servizio di MT onli ne offerto dalla piattaforma Google Translate e produce quindi traduzioni automatiche fondate sull'approccio statistico (per una definizione di traduzione

automatica statistica, si veda sezione 1.3).

L'app Google Translate (a cui da qui si farà riferimento anche come GT) traduce in circa 90 lingue (rispetto alle oltre 100 supportate dalla piattaforma online) e, oltre alla classica traduzione automatica di testo digitato, offre servizi studiati appositamente per l'utilizzo da dispositivo mobile.30 Questi includono ad esempio:

 le modalità “Scatti” e “Visualizzazione”,31 che consentono di

utilizzare la fotocamera per sottoporre all’app il testo da tradurre desiderato;32 grazie a queste funzioni è sufficiente inquadrare (modalità “Visualizzazione”) o fotografare (modalità “Scatti”) il testo da tradurre per ottenerne la traduzione istantanea;

 la modalità “Scrittura”, che consente di tracciare il testo da tradurre con il dito, utilizzando il touchscreen del dispositivo;33 questa funzione si rivela utile soprattutto pe r lingue come il cinese e il giapponese, che non utilizzano l'alfabeto latino, bensì caratteri, pittogrammi e ideogrammi (generalmente non disponibili nella tastiera touch dei dispositivi mobili venduti in Europa);

 la modalità “Conversazione”, che consente di intrattenere conversazioni bilingue;34 questa funzione, disponibile per circa 40

lingue,35 si basa sulla tecnologia Speech -to-Speech Translation.

Alcune delle funzioni elencate sono disponibili anche offline (ovvero in assenza di connessione internet) pr evio download dei pacchetti dati relativi alle lingue desiderate (opzione disponibile solo per dispositivi Android o per dispositivi Apple limitatamente alla modalità “Visualizzazione”). Occorre ricordare, inoltre, che alcune funzioni sono disponibili solo in un numero

30 Google, Google Play Apps: Google Traduttore. Visitato: 20/04/2016. Link:

https://play.google.com/store/apps/details?id=com.google.android.apps.translate

31 Google, Google Translate: Lingue. Visitato: 20/04/2016. Link:

http://translate.google.it/about/intl/it_ALL/languages/

32 Google, Google Play Apps: Google Traduttore. Visitato: 20/04/2016. Link:

https://play.google.com/store/apps/details?id=com.google.android.apps.translate

33 Google, Google Translate: Lingue. Visitato: 20/04/2016. Link:

http://translate.google.it/about/intl/it_ALL/languages/

34 Ibid. . Link: http://translate.google.it/about/intl/it_ALL/languages/ 35 Google, Google Play Apps: Google Traduttore. Visitato: 20/04/2016. Link:

ridotto di lingue, rispetto alle circa 90 offerte dall'applicazione.36

La valutazione di Google Translate nell'ambito del test descritto in questo capitolo verte unicamente sulla traduzione automatica del parlato, ovvero sulla modalità “Conversazione” dell'app. Per accedere a questa funzione, dalla schermata principale è sufficiente selezionare le lingue desiderate e successivamente l'icona del microfono, come mostrato in Figura 2.

Figura 2

Schermata principale dell'app Google Translate.

Una volta selezionata l'icona del microfono, si aprirà una nuova schermata (Figura 3).

Figura 3

Schermata della modalità “Conversazione” (GT).

All'utente sarà sufficiente pronunciare la frase da tradurre nella lingua selezionata (visualizzata in rosso) co me source (input vocale nella lingua source); nella parte superiore della schermata comparirà poi la trascrizione della frase pronunciata così come riconosciuta dal modulo ASR. A partire da questo primo output verrà prodotta una traduzione automatica nella lingua target, che comparirà immediatamente nella parte inferiore dello schermo (output tradotto in forma scritta). Qualora non si avvii automaticamente la sintesi vocale della traduzione, sarà possibile ascoltarla selezionando nuovamente l'icona del microfono; in questo modo si interromperà il processo di riconoscimento vocale e la traduzione verrà riprodotta dal modulo di sintesi vocale (output vocale nella lingua target). Per passare alla direzione opposta di traduzione, è sufficiente selezionare sul di splay la nuova lingua che si desidera utilizzare come source. Toccando invece il microfono al centro della schermata (Figura 3) verrà attivata la funzione “Ascolto in entrambe le lingue”, che permette all'applicazione di rilevare automaticamente la lingua dell'input vocale immesso.

La funzione “Conversazione” può essere particolarmente utile sia nel caso in cui l'utente che si avvale della traduzione automatica non sia in grado di pronunciare l'output prodotto, sia nel caso in cui due utenti di lingue diverse vogliano intrattenere una conversazione mediata dall'app. Di fatto, la modalità “Conversazione” offre una vera e propria traduzione automatica del parlato pensata per un contesto interattivo: si parte da un input orale, che viene riconosciuto dal modulo ASR quasi istantaneamente, per poi passare al modulo di traduzione automatica, che lo traduce altrettanto velocemente (avvalendosi in questo caso di un approccio statistico); infine l'output tradotto viene riprodotto dal modulo di sintesi vocale.

Durante questi passaggi è possibile dapprima verificare l'accuratezza del riconoscimento vocale, il che consente all'utente di ripetere o digitare manualmente la frase da tradurre nel caso in cui il riconoscimento non sia andato a buon fine, e in un secondo momen to visualizzare il testo tradotto in forma scritta. Non esiste tuttavia alcuna possibilità di intervento sulla traduzione fornita dall'applicazione, né la possibilità di fornire un feedback (opzione prevista solo per la piattaforma online di Google Transla te). Se l'utente lo desidera, è possibile invece salvare le traduzioni in un elenco di

preferiti, selezionando l'apposita icona a forma di stella dalla schermata principale dell'applicazione.

Al momento della stesura di questo elaborato, Google Translate o ffre la traduzione automatica del parlato per circa 3037 delle 90 lingue supportate dall'applicazione.